In the operation mode POSITION DECODING, the module works as an up–
cription of the Po-
counter/down–counter and counts the pulses of the connected position en-
sition Decoder
coder. Based on the phase offset of the two decoder signals A and B, the
counter determines the counting direction. If the counter reaches a prese-
lected setpoint, the respective output is then turned on.

Counter capacity
The 16–bit up/down counter permits a resolution of 65,536 units between
– 32768 and +32767. The traversing range depends on the resolution of
the position encoders.
Pulse evaluation
The counting pulses, which are offset by 90 degrees, can be subjected to
single, double, or quadruple evaluation. The necessary setting is made on
the operating mode switch (see Figure 9-7).
The accuracy of the traversing path increases accordingly if double or
quadruple pulse evaluation is used. However, the traversing range then
available is reduced by a factor of 2 or 4 (see Table 9-3).
